Description

Senior Vehicle Systems Engineer is required to provide Engineering expertise into the Survivability Team. The candidate will work within a team of engineers reporting to the Lead Survivability Engineer and will be given responsibility for aspects of the Engineering activity associated primarily with the Survivability solution. The role requires a breadth of engineering skills combined with good people skills and a 'can do' attitude to deliver on time, on cost to support a demanding programme schedule. An ability to learn quickly on the job and be a proactive self-starter will be required
Typical activities will include:

  • Survivability support to system design activities.
  • Preparing, overseeing and reporting Survivability trials at both sub system and vehicle level.
  • Root cause analysis and investigation relating to the Survivability domain product as required.
  • Support to production activities relating to the Survivability domain product.
  • Preparation, configuration and change management of Survivability related Engineering artefacts (specifications, interface control documents, test specifications, test reports etc.).
  • Liaison with the customer during design reviews/workshops etc.
  • Liaison with subcontractors including governance and design reviews/workshops.
  • System and Sub-system issues management and resolution including reporting.
  • Support the change management process for sub-contract and customer contract changes.
  • Provide information and metrics to the Team Lead to enable management reporting.
